Transaction a6476c33aa1fcfeb70866313457072823a130dd880b7ef558db82800406d1826
1 Input
1 Output
-
a6476c33aa1fcfeb70866313457072823a130dd880b7ef558db82800406d1826:0
- value
- 1453217
- script pubkey
- OP_0 OP_PUSHBYTES_20 47e4fe5e039c3dbb4b0863ee648ada1e8ea15ea7
- address
- bc1qglj0uhsrns7mkjcgv0hxfzk6r682zh480mj7qs